A Study of DKN-01 in Combination With Tislelizumab ± Chemotherapy in Patients With Gastric or Gastroesophageal Cancer

Official title
A Phase 2, Multicenter, Open-Label Study of DKN-01 in Combination With Tislelizumab ± Chemotherapy as First-Line or Second-Line Therapy in Adult Patients With Inoperable, Locally Advanced or Metastatic Gastric or Gastroesophageal Junction Adenocarcinoma (DisTinGuish)
Study identification
- NCT ID
- NCT04363801
- Recruitment status
- Terminated
- Study type
- Interventional
- Phase
- Phase 2
- Lead sponsor
- Leap Therapeutics, Inc.
- Industry
- Enrollment
- 247 participants
Conditions and interventions
Interventions
- Capecitabine 1000mg/ m2 twice daily (BID) Drug
- DKN-01 300mg Drug
- DKN-01 400mg Drug
- DKN-01 600mg Drug
- Fluorouracil Drug
- Leucovorin Calcium Drug
- Oxaliplatin Drug
- Tislelizumab 200mg Drug
- Tislelizumab 400mg Drug
